Maun vs Cobar Mo Climate & Distance Between

Australia flag
  • The distance between Maun, Botswana and Cobar Mo, Australia is approximately 11,625 km or 7,224 mi.
  • To reach Maun in this distance one would set out from Cobar Mo bearing 235°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Maun bearing 311.9° or NW .
  • Both have a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Both are in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 3.1 °C (5.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.6 °C (10.1°F) less in Maun.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 60.4 mm (2.4 in) more which is equivalent to 60.4 l/m² (1.48 US gal/ft²) or 604,000 l/ha (64,572 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.4° higher in Maun than in Cobar Mo.
